> > > +    /* changes callback functions */
> > > +    ctx->get_buffer2 = avctx->get_buffer2;
> > > +    avctx->get_format = get_format;
> > Are you sure it is valid to basically ignore the get_format of the user
?
> >
> > > +    avctx->get_buffer2 = get_buffer2;
> > You overload the get_buffer2 but I do not see you overloading the
> > associated
> > release function. So it probably means you are not releasing correctly
the
> > dxva2
> > surface handle that get associated to the picture by get_buffer2...
> > *

*> I reference the code of ffmpeg, and vda_h264_dec.c , it seems that the
> release function is not valid in this version*

* If you don't overload the release function you will leaks surfaces, the
current code in dxva2 will try to workaround it, but it may creates broken
pictures (it will depends on the streams). Have a look at the VLC code.*

*I have already read the code of the VLC and I didn`t find the code about
the overloading of the get_buffer2. Can you give me some details of the
overloading of the get_buffer2? Which file I should read in the VLC code?*
